How often should you wash hankies?
Think of your hankies the same as underwear, it’s okay to use them all day but you need to wash them at the end of it. If it gets wet, change it sooner and if you’re not well, change it immediately. You’ll want a rotation of at least seven hankies so that you can use a fresh one every day.
How do you care for a handkerchief?
When it comes down to cleaning your handkerchief, we recommend washing it in the machine with the rest of your laundry (no the snot will not “contaminate” your other clothes!). We suggest washing the hankies in cold to lukewarm water for a regular use (20 degrees is the ideal temperature, in our opinion).

How do you wash handkerchief linens?
Wash your linen fabric in a washing machine using a hot water cycle. Dry the linen completely in the dryer for added shrinkage. Wet the linen back down and press it dry to remove any wrinkles. You can also not dry it fully and press it the rest of the way dry.
How do you remove mucus from fabric?
Urine, Mucus, or Baby Formula on Clothes Start by scraping off any residue. Mix half a teaspoon of liquid dishwashing soap and a tablespoon of ammonia into a quart of lukewarm water. Soak the fabric for about 15 minutes and then rub the stain gently with a cloth.
Why we should not gift handkerchief?
It is believed that gifting a handkerchief will bring bad luck. As per beliefs, it has something to do with inviting sobbing. Thai believe that handkerchief is used for wiping tears, so someone who receives a handkerchief as a gift will lose their tears. If you don’t want your beloved to cry, avoid giving this item.

Can You boil a handkerchief to clean it?
Boil your handkerchiefs. If you don’t want to bleach your handkerchiefs, you can kill bacteria and viruses by putting the handkerchiefs in a pot of boiling water, then immediately taking the pot off the burner and allowing it to cool. When the water cools, throw the handkerchiefs in with a load of laundry.
Can you put a hanky in the washing machine?
Throw your hanky in the wash along with other clothing items. If you wash your underwear or bed linens separately, you could throw in the handkerchiefs with these. Otherwise, any wash will do. Set your washing machine for a normal cycle, making sure the water is at least 20 degrees warm.
How many handkerchiefs should I buy?
Buy at least 10 handkerchiefs. You’ll need to throw your hanky in the laundry every time it’s reasonably soiled. A good rule of thumb is that your handkerchief should never feel damp when you put your hand in your pocket to grab it.
